Text animators animate character position, rotation, and size-related properties relative to an anchor point. You can use the text property, Anchor Point Grouping, to specify whether the anchor point used for transformations is that of each character, each word, each line, or the entire text block. In addition, you can control the alignment of the characters’ anchor points relative to the anchor point of the group with the Grouping Alignment property.

Choose how to group the text layer’s character anchor points from the Anchor Point Grouping menu.
Lower the Grouping Alignment values to move each anchor point up and to the left.
Raise the Grouping Alignment values to move each anchor point down and to the right.
To center
the anchor point in a string of capital letters, try a Grouping
Alignment value of 0%, -50%. To center the anchor point in a string
of lowercase letters, or if you’re using both lowercase and uppercase
letters, try 0%, -25%.
